Posts: 869
I dunno why u guys pickin on this kid. He probably raced an auto convetable 95 mustang. (215hp 3500lbs). Very possible to beat with a modded 5 spd max. Most mustangs are not that quick for a v8 (ls1 pwnz), only one I respect is the s/ced cobra.
As for your lug nuts... mine were loose too when I had my axles done, they were all hand loose and 1 was missing... I suspect someone be ****ing with my car or trying to steal my rims or some****... Tighten them back up and race around, see if they get loose again. Chances are whoever worked on your car last did not tighten them down tight enough, so they got loose over time.
